The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ion Hints
How can I do this the sneaky ambush way?
1 of 9: Start by talking to each of the three battlemages about "Abilities" to see what each is best at.
2 of 9: Then talk to them about "Positions" to choose a position for each.
3 of 9: The best way is to have all three of them keep their distance so the necromancers won't see them until after they're well away from Silorn's entrance door.
4 of 9: After they all run over to their spot, go over there and talk to Thalfin again.
5 of 9: Then stand next to the large chunk of ruins nearest them so that the necromancer party won't see you as they approach.
6 of 9: When the battlemages see the necros and go into attack mode, rush out and start attacking Falcar right away. (He's the tallest one, with yellowish skin and fancier clothes than the others.)
7 of 9: He's a real chicken, and will probably start running straight back to Silorn's door as soon as you or your battlemages are spotted, so it may not be possible to keep him from escaping the ambush.
8 of 9: One way to stop him from getting away is to quickly hit him with a spell or poisoned arrow that will paralyze him.
9 of 9: Or if you're really fast, you could start running straight for the entrance to Silorn as soon as the battle starts in hopes of intercepting Falcar before he can get back inside.
